Akra Phatak, Metiabruz, Kolkata


Railway Crossing – Akra Phatak is a significant railway level crossing located in Metiabruz, a historical locality within Kolkata, West Bengal. It serves as a crucial point for both local residents and commuters, connecting different parts of the area across the railway lines.


Why people come here

Commute & Access – People primarily come to Akra Phatak for daily commuting, as it provides access to various neighborhoods and commercial areas. It's a common thoroughfare for pedestrians, cyclists, and vehicles.


What to expect

Bustling & Local – I find Akra Phatak to be a busy, bustling spot, especially during peak hours. You can expect a constant flow of local traffic, including rickshaws, auto-rickshaws, and pedestrians. It offers a glimpse into the everyday life of the Metiabruz area.


Best time to go

Off-peak Hours – To avoid the heaviest crowds and potential delays, I'd suggest visiting during off-peak hours, typically mid-morning or late afternoon. Early mornings can also be quieter.


Practical info

Traffic & Safety – Be mindful of the railway crossing gates and train schedules, as delays can occur. Pedestrians should exercise caution due to the heavy traffic. While there aren't specific facilities for visitors, local shops and vendors are usually nearby.


Good to know

Historical Context – Metiabruz itself has a rich history, known for being the last residence of Nawab Wajid Ali Shah of Oudh. While Akra Phatak is a functional point, its surroundings are steeped in this historical past.
